Mikael Ståldal commented on LOG4J2-1694: ---------------------------------------- Thanks. That is a valid use case. I have a similar use case myself, and use GelfLayout which has this functionallity: {code} <GelfLayout host="user"> <KeyValuePair key="environment" value="prod"/> <KeyValuePair key="application" value="whatever"/> </GelfLayout> {code} So I guess you would like something similar for JsonLayout?
